Work environment :This position is part of a nationally funded research project focused on the early detection of neurodegenerative diseases through the analysis of protein aggregates in biological fluids. The project aims to develop and refine a cutting-edge single-molecule detection platform that leverages molecular amplification and nanoscale sensing to identify and characterize disease-related biomarkers at ultra-low concentrations. The ultimate goal is to establish new diagnostic strategies based on the structural profiling of protein aggregates, with potential applications in personalized medicine.
Main mission : The successful candidate will join a multidisciplinary team to explore the biophysical mechanisms of protein aggregation and contribute to the development of a novel detection technique.
Activities : The work will involve experimental investigations using advanced single molecule detection tools.
